Problems solved by technology

[0005] (1) It is difficult to measure. Although the absolute displacement of key points can be measured by measuring instruments (such as total station and level), when unloading complex temporary supports, the absolute displacement of key points is not always downward, but It is possible to go upwards, such as the steel shell of the National Grand Theater; and the reaction force of the jack is used as a control variable, which cannot be measured in real time on site
[0006] (2) The operation is inconvenient. Whether it is the absolute displacement or the jack reaction force as the control variable, it is not convenient for the on-site unloading workers to operate
[0007] (3) It cannot be compared with the calculation results of simulation analysis in real time, it is difficult to control, and it is difficult to guarantee safety

Abstract

Disclosed is an unloading control method for steel structure temporary bracing. The method comprises that simulation analysis of an overall construction process of an integral structure is performed, so that unloading quantities of various bracing points on a temporary bracing structure are determined, the integral structure comprises a main structure and the temporary bracing structure, and jacks are respectively arranged at positions of the bracing points on the temporary bracing structure for supporting the main structure; unloading is performed through adjustment of routes of the jacks; route changes of the jacks are measured based on the unloading quantities determined by the simulation analysis, so that the routes of the jacks are in accordance with the unloading quantities of corresponding bracing points determined by the simulation analysis; and the next step of unloading is performed in the same way, and finally synchronous unloading is achieved through grading sorted unloading. The unloading control method has the advantages that the routes of the jacks are used as control variables in unloading construction of the steel structure temporary bracing, the unloading quantities can be controlled accurately, real-time measurement is performed conveniently, the accuracy is high, the safety is guaranteed, and the like.

Description

technical field [0001] The invention relates to the technical field of steel structure construction, in particular to a method for controlling unloading of temporary supports of steel structures. Background technique [0002] The unloading technology of temporary supports for steel structures is a key technology in the construction process of steel structures. Whether the implementation of the unloading scheme is reasonable is related to the safety of the main structure and the temporary structure and the quality of the main structure. A reasonable unloading method not only ensures the safety of the structure, but also is simple and easy to operate implement.
